What Today’s Guests Actually Want
Whether you’re running a boutique hotel, a dozen rentals, or a family-run guesthouse, your guests are bringing new expectations. They want:
-
Self-service check-in without app downloads
-
Clear communication, automated but still warm
-
The ability to pay, request extras, and get info—without emailing you at midnight
This kind of experience doesn’t just make guests happy—it builds trust. And trust leads to better reviews, more repeat bookings, and fewer fires to put out.
